The Shoulder Isn’t Broken — It’s Overcompensating
Let’s be clear: a clunky shoulder doesn’t always mean injury.
But it usually means your body is compensating for a deeper issue somewhere else.
Most people try to fix shoulder pain or dysfunction by:
Stretching tight pecs
Strengthening the rotator cuff
Mobilising the thoracic spine
Getting regular sports massage
These can be helpful — but only if the shoulder is the real problem.
More often than not, the shoulder is just the last link in a faulty movement chain.
The Real Cause Is Often Deeper
When muscles like the diaphragm, glutes, and psoas (known in Be-Activated as Zone 1) aren’t firing properly, your body loses its core stability.
To keep you upright and moving, smaller muscles — like the traps, neck, and shoulders — take over the job.
That means your shoulder is:
Doing extra stabilisation work
Bracing instead of flowing
Struggling for control under load
The result?
Clunkiness, tightness, pinching, or weird clicks — especially during pressing or pulling movements.
